## Runbook: GrowHaven sensor drift

So, the humidity probes in the Aldermere greenhouse drift upward after about three weeks — nobody knows exactly why, probably condensation on the housing. When readings creep past plausible bounds, the controller starts overcorrecting the vents, and the tomatoes suffer. Fix: trigger a recalibration cycle from the admin panel, then restart the controller daemon. After restart, verify the daemon comes up with the following configuration values.

settings of bawif-fawif:
ralix:
  log_level: warn
  metrics_host: metrics.ralix.tolvaqsys.internal
  pool_size: 32

# MergeMinnow Environments

MergeMinnow, our customer-record dedupe service, runs in three environments: sandbox (synthetic data only), staging (weekly prod snapshot, anonymized), and production. Matching thresholds and blocking keys differ per environment, which has caused confusion in past syncs, so this page is now the source of truth. Staging mirrors prod except for queue sizes. The production configuration currently in effect is as follows.

service settings:
[casax]
port = 6379
team = rusir
host = casax.zemvarhq.corp
region = outer-4
access_code = ac_9808ce
timeout_ms = 1500

## Runbook: Tidewhistle widget — restart procedure

The Tidewhistle tide-table widget pulls predictions from the Carnmouth harmonic service every six hours. If charts go blank, check the fetch worker first; a failed fetch leaves a lock file that blocks retries. Remove the lock, restart the worker, and confirm the next high-tide entry renders for the Pellhaven station. Do not restart the renderer while a fetch is in flight. The worker reads the following configuration values at startup.

config for kafof-bawef:
holath:
  log_level: debug
  metrics_host: metrics.holath.qorvelsys.internal
  pin: 2191
  pool_size: 32

Subject: FD leak hunt — action needed from plugin authors

Hi all,

We've been chasing leaked file descriptors in the Marrowbeam host process, and instrumentation now points at third-party plugins that open temp files during render but skip cleanup on cancellation. Starting with the next beta, the sandbox will log and close orphaned descriptors, which may surface warnings in your plugins. Please test against the new build and patch any leaks before GA. The beta in question carries the build token below.

session token of bawep-yadup = htk21_528abd376e3c5a4ec24a1